Minister of Forestry, Fisheries and Environment, David Maynier, has expressed satisfaction with the progress made so far in the recovery of the infrastructure that was damaged by the floods in January. Several roads, bridges, and rest camps were seriously damaged. The total extent of the damage was estimated at 950 million Rand. Minister Maynier officiated the handover of projects completed, such as the bridge on the Lower Sabie Road. Mthobisi Mkhaliphi reports....
